发明名称 一种转码处理方法、装置及服务器
摘要 本发明实施例提供一种转码处理方法、装置及服务器,其中的方法可包括:当接收到转码请求时,获取至少一个转码节点所组成的转码集群的空闲率;根据所述转码集群的空闲率,对所述至少一个转码节点进行随机负载分配处理,以从所述至少一个转码节点中选取响应转码节点;将所述转码请求发送至所述响应转码节点,以使所述响应转码节点根据所述转码请求进行转码处理。本发明可实现转码集群中各转码节点的负载均衡,同时保证转码质量。
申请公布号 CN104202305B 申请公布日期 2016.04.27
申请号 CN201410397925.4 申请日期 2014.08.13
申请人 腾讯科技(深圳)有限公司 发明人 管坤;曾新海
分类号 H04L29/06(2006.01)I 主分类号 H04L29/06(2006.01)I
代理机构 广州三环专利代理有限公司 44202 代理人 郝传鑫;熊永强
主权项 一种转码处理方法,其特征在于,包括:当接收到转码请求时,获取至少一个转码节点所组成的转码集群的空闲率,所述转码集群的空闲率为所述至少一个转码节点中各转码节点的空闲率之和;采用预设数值范围内的随机数对所述转码集群的空闲率进行加权处理,获得随机分配数值;获取所述各转码节点在所述转码集群中的接入顺序;按照所述各转码节点在所述转码集群中的接入顺序,将所述随机分配数值与所述各转码节点的空闲率进行递减运算;根据所述递减运算结果,从所述至少一个转码节点中选取响应转码节点,包括:当所述随机分配数值与第一至第M‑1个转码节点的空闲率进行递减运算获得的差值大于预设值,且所述随机分配数值与第一至第M个转码节点的空闲率进行递减运算获得的差值小于预设值时,从所述至少一个转码节点中选取第M个转码节点;将所述第M个转码节点确定为响应转码节点;其中,M为正整数;M的取值大于等于1,且小于等于所述至少一个转码节点的数量;其中,随机负载分配处理用于使所述转码集群中各转码节点负载均衡,满足所述转码集群的全局空闲率的要求,且保证转码质量;将所述转码请求发送至所述响应转码节点,以使所述响应转码节点根据所述转码请求进行转码处理。
地址 518000 广东省深圳市福田区振兴路赛格科技园2栋东403室